Definition of Ablactetion	
	    			    		
		    		Ab`lac*ta"tion (&?;). n. 1.
The weaning of a child from the breast, or of young beasts from their
dam.  Blount. 
2. (Hort.) The process of grafting now
called inarching, or grafting by approach. 
  
		    		 - Webster's Unabridged Dictionary (1913)
